What role does page speed play in mobile SEO?

How Page Speed Impacts Mobile SEO

Page speed is one of the most critical components of mobile SEO optimization. When users visit a website on their phones, they often expect pages to load in just a couple of seconds. If a site takes too long, visitors may quickly abandon it, increasing bounce rates and lowering the likelihood of repeat visits. Search engines take these user behaviors into account, ranking faster-loading sites more favorably than slower ones. This means that if your mobile pages are sluggish, not only do you risk losing potential customers, but you could also see your organic visibility drop.

Beyond ranking factors, page speed significantly influences the user experience. Modern audiences are increasingly on the go, with little patience for buffering or delayed loading times. Slow pages often deter visitors from exploring your content, even if it is valuable. In contrast, a fast website draws people in, encourages them to explore multiple pages, and increases the chance of them completing desired actions—such as filling out a form or making a purchase. By focusing on page speed, you can improve overall user satisfaction, reduce frustration, and cultivate a more engaging environment for your mobile users.

Another key insight is how page speed ties into conversion rates. Studies show that even a one- or two-second improvement in loading time can lead to noticeable increases in sign-ups and sales. Faster pages keep users hooked, encouraging deeper exploration of your services or products. Moreover, when search engines like Google gauge a site’s mobile experience, they review factors such as responsiveness and interactivity—both of which can be hindered by slow loading speeds. By prioritizing speed, you’re effectively tackling multiple aspects of mobile SEO, from discoverability to user retention.
